ATLANTA, Ga. (Atlanta News First) - If you’re flying out of Hartsfield-Jackson airport late this week, you might want to budget some extra time to get to your plane.
The airport announced that there will be adjusted service lasting from late Wednesday night into Thursday morning, and late Thursday night into Friday morning.
From 11 p.m. to 5 a.m., the plane train will be in “shuttle mode,” meaning longer wait times between trains, the airport said.
There will be two different shuttles: one between concourses T and E and one between concourses E and F.
Between midnight and 2 a.m. Thursday, service between concourses E and F will be suspended.
The system will shut down completely between 2 a.m. and 4 a.m. Thursday and Friday.
The airport said staff will be available to help passengers.
